Background
The semitrailer is that the vehicle focus is placed in at the back to be equipped with the trailer that can transmit the coupling device of tractor with level and vertical force, along with the automobile pulls the rapid development of transportation, the semitrailer trains receives more and more favor as a bearing capacity is strong and high-efficient, convenient transportation, and the semitrailer comprises tractor and carriage, and connects through the fifth wheel between tractor and the carriage.
The traction seat is an important assembly on a semi-trailer train, and has the functions of transmitting longitudinal force between a tractor and a semi-trailer and ensuring the steering capacity of the semi-trailer train, so that the reliability of the matching connection part of the traction seat and a traction pin is very important.
The fifth wheel is connected on the tractor, when tractor and carriage articulate, drive the fifth wheel through the tractor and remove, on the fifth wheel is pegged graft to the pin that pulls who connects on the carriage, thereby link to each other tractor and carriage, but among the prior art the fifth wheel all adopts casting integration mechanism, consequently when articulating, the towing pin often can lead to the fact stronger striking to the fifth wheel, thereby can lead to the fact the damage to the fifth wheel and lead to the condition that the fifth wheel takes place the fracture even, reduce the life of the fifth wheel, and lead to certain potential safety hazard for the transportation, consequently, there is some weak points in the fifth wheel among the prior art.

Referring to fig. 1-4, a transportation semitrailer traction seat comprises a traction seat plate 1, a latch hook 3 and a pull rod 4, wherein the pull rod 4 is connected to the side wall of the traction seat plate 1, the latch hook 3 is connected to the inside of the traction seat plate 1, one end of the pull rod 4 penetrates through the traction seat plate 1 and is connected with a connecting rod 402, one end of the connecting rod 402 far away from the pull rod 4 is rotatably connected to the inner wall of the traction seat plate 1, the outer wall of the connecting rod 402 is connected with a wedge 403, a clamping groove matched with the wedge 403 is formed in the latch hook 3, a groove is formed in the top wall of the traction seat plate 1, a sliding plate 2 is slidably connected in the groove, a fixing plate 6 is connected to the inner wall of the sliding plate 2, a telescopic rod 601 and a damping mechanism are connected to the inner wall of the fixing plate 6, the damping mechanism, one end of the second connecting rod 701 far away from the first connecting rod 7 is rotatably connected to the inner wall of the traction seat plate 1, and a third elastic member 702 is connected between the inner wall of the second connecting rod 701 and the outer wall of the telescopic rod 601.
Referring to fig. 1 to 4, the telescopic rod 601 includes an outer rod 602, a piston 603 and an inner rod 604, the outer rod 602 is connected to the inner wall of the traction base plate 1, the piston 603 is connected to the inner wall of the outer rod 602, the inner rod 604 is connected to the outer wall of the piston 603, and the end of the inner rod 604 far from the piston 603 is connected to the fixing plate 6.
Referring to fig. 2-3, the inner wall of the traction seat plate 1 is connected with a first fixing block and a second fixing block, the first fixing block is connected with a first elastic element 301, one end of the first elastic element 301, which is far away from the first fixing block, is connected to the side wall of the locking hook 3, the second fixing block is connected with a second elastic element 404, and one end of the second elastic element 404, which is far away from the second fixing block, is connected with the pull rod 4.
Referring to fig. 1, wear-resistant rings 201 are connected to the traction seat plate 1 and the sliding plate 2, and the wear-resistant rings 201 are matched.
Referring to fig. 2, the inner wall of the traction seat plate 1 is connected with a slide rail 101, and the wedge 403 is slidably connected with the slide rail 101.
Referring to fig. 2 to 3, a pull ring 401 is attached to an outer wall of the pull rod 4.
Referring to fig. 1, the bottom wall of the traction seat plate 1 is rotatably connected with a connecting plate 5, a threaded hole is formed in the connecting plate 5, and a bolt is connected to the inner portion of the threaded hole.
When the tractor is hooked with the carriage, the pull ring 401 is pulled to drive the pull rod 4 to move, and further drive the connecting rod 402 connected to the outer wall of the pull rod 4 to rotate, and further drive the wedge block 403 to be separated from the latch hook 3, and then under the action of the elastic force of the first elastic element 301, the latch hook 3 is driven to rotate, and then the tractor is started to drive the traction seat to move, so that the open slot on the traction seat plate 1 is matched with the traction pin, when the traction pin abuts against the latch hook 3, the traction seat is continuously moved, and further the latch hook 3 is driven to rotate clockwise, and further the traction pin is clamped inside the latch hook 3, when the traction pin impacts the sliding plate 2, a strong acting force is further exerted on the sliding plate 2, and further the sliding plate 2 and the fixing plate 6 are driven to move, and further the telescopic rod 601 and the damping mechanism are acted on the, thereby driving the first connecting rod 7 and the second connecting rod 701 to rotate, further increasing the angle between the second connecting rod 701 and the telescopic rod 601, thereby stretching the third elastic member 702, and at the same time, the third elastic member 702 exerts an opposite force on the fixing plate 6, thereby playing a good role in buffering and damping the fixed plate 6, effectively avoiding the damage to the traction seat plate 1 caused by the strong impact of the traction pin on the traction seat plate 1 when the carriage is articulated with the tractor, thereby prolonging the service life of the traction seat plate 1, ensuring the driving safety of the semi-trailer transport vehicle, and simultaneously, under the action of the elastic force of the third elastic member 702, the sliding plate 2 is pushed to return to the original position, so that the wear-resistant ring 201 on the traction seat plate 1 is clamped with the traction pin, thereby ensuring the stability of the trailer and the carriage and further ensuring the driving safety of the semitrailer.
Through the setting of second elastic component 404 to be convenient for drive pull rod 4 and reply original position, and then drive voussoir 403 and latch hook 3 looks joint, guarantee latch hook 3 to the locking of towing pin, through the setting of slide rail 101, thereby guarantee that voussoir 403 can match with the draw-in groove on the latch hook 3 and link to each other, through the setting of connecting plate 5, be convenient for connect the fifth wheel on the tractor.
